Abstract

The invention relates to an apparatus for exchanging material between blood and a gas/gas mixture, comprising a chamber () through which blood can flow and in which a plurality of material-permeable fiber tubes is provided, the gas/gas mixture being flowable through the fiber tubes, blood being flowable around the fiber tubes. At least one deformable element () is provided in the chamber () in addition to the fiber tubes, through which the gas/gas mixture can flow, this deformable element being deformable and restorable, in particular compressible out of a relaxed shape and restorable to a relaxed shape by pressure fluctuations acting on the at least one element () externally, in particular pressure fluctuations transmitted by the blood in the chamber ().
